摘要:
We present a powerful new approach to compute tree -level higher -point holographic correlators. Our method only exploits the flat -space limit, where we point out an important simplification, and factorization of amplitudes in AdS. In particular, it makes minimal use of supersymmetry, crucial in all previous bootstrap methods. We demonstrate our method by computing the six -point super gluon amplitude of super Yang -Mills in AdS5.
